ADVERTISING REGULATORY COUNCIL OF NIGERIA ACT, 2022

Section 63: Interpretation.

In this Act- “advertisement” means a notice, announcement, exposure, publication, broadcast, statement, announcorial, informercial, commercial, hype, display,
town cry, show, event, logo, payoff or trademark to promote, advocate, solicit, showcase, endorse, vote or support a product, service, cause, idea,
person or organisation with the intention to influence, sway, actuate, impress, arouse, patronise, entice or attract a person, people or organisation by an
identified sponsor irrespective of media, medium or platform ;
“advertisement agency” means any agent, agency or organisation that nengages in full advertising service, creative advertising, media buying, media
planning, media brokerage, experiential marketing, activation, out of home advertising, brand consulting, brand management, digital advertising or any
other advertising, marketing communications service ;
“advertiser” means a person, private or public organisation that causes, requests, directs, or pays for an advertisement, advertising or marketing
communications ideas to be created, developed, produced, executed, expose or that takes benefit of advertisement, advertising, and marketing communication services ;
“advertising” means any act, action, activity, construct or undertaking directly, or indirectly, intentionally, or unintentionally, aimed at creating, planning,
strategising, managing, developing, producing, propagating, servicing or facilitating an advertisement, brand or marketing communications ideas ;
“advertising practitioner” means a person registered by APCON to practice advertisement, advertising and marketing communications in Nigeria ;
“Council” means the Advertising Regulatory Council of Nigeria established under section 1 of this Act ;
“Court” means a court of law in Nigeria with competent jurisdiction ;
“Director-General” means the Chief Executive Officer appointed under section 11 of this Act ;
“foreign advertiser” means a non-Nigerian or non-Nigerian organisation that causes, requests, directs, or pays for an advertisement, advertising or marketing communications ideas to be created, developed, produced, executed, expose or that takes benefit of advertisement, advertising, and marketing communication services in Nigeria or directed at Nigeria market ;
“foreign advertising practitioner” means a person other than a registered Nigerian practitioner, firm, company or agency who practice advertising directed at the Nigerian market ;
“Governing Council” means the Governing Council established under section 3 of this Act ;
“Government” includes the Government of the Federation, State, Local Government Area or any of their ministry, department, agency or any person or organ exercising power or authority on their behalf ;
“Marketing Communications” means any act, gesture, endeavour, execution, performance tactics or effort aimed at sharing promotional information, evoking emotion, creating awareness or encouraging demand for a product, service, cause, idea, person or organisation through the use of public media, mass media, or any medium capable of disseminating information to the public directly, or indirectly, intentionally, or unintentionally ;
“media” means any medium, channel, platform that disseminate, circulate,
expose, broadcast, publish, display or make public an advertisement ;
“Minister” means the Minister responsible for information and advertising ;
“practice” means any act, conduct, ideation, design or conceptualisation that leads to the development, creation, co-creation, production or delivery of an advertisement ;
“President” means the President of the Federal Republic of Nigeria ;
“Register” means the register maintained in pursuance of this Act ; and
“registered” means registered as a fellow, member, associate or student member of the profession in the part of the register relating to fellows, members, associates or students, as the case may be.
